What companies run services between Cologne, Germany and Genoa, Italy?

Lufthansa City, Air Dolomiti, and five other airlines fly from Cologne Bonn Airport (CGN) to Genoa Cristoforo Colombo Airport (GOA) twice daily. Alternatively, you can take a train from Köln Hbf to Genova Brignole via Basel SBB, Lugano, and Milano Centrale in around 13h 36m.
